taking pills after surgery
DonRodolfo replied to birdmadgirl's topic in PRE-Operation Weight Loss Surgery Q&A
You really need to discuss this with your surgeon. I was crushing/splitting mine for a few days before i realized not all meds are meant to be crushed or split. Some are time-release and need to stay intact in order to release into your system properly. -

what is a good 'PRE-operation DIET , so not to gain, and to get into what is good for the Sleeve
DonRodolfo replied to JewelJ's topic in PRE-Operation Weight Loss Surgery Q&A
The responses are going to vary widely as different surgeons have different requirements. For insurance purposes, I was told I could stay the same weight or lose weight but not gain weight under any circumstances. Two-weeks prior to surgery was the liquid-only 2-week preop diet which consisted of Bariatric Advantage Protein shakes (that my surgeon required i buy from him) and sugar-free Jello or popcicles and low-sodium broth if I absolutely had to. The 24 hours before surgery i could have Clear liquids only (Isopure RTD). After surgery i was released immediately to full liquids, then soft foods, then most regular food (after 7 weeks). What my nut had me work on before surgery - do not drink with meals or for 30 minutes afterwards. This is harder than you think and the sooner you get into the habit the better. - chew each bite 20-30 times each. Also harder than it seems. - learn to eat meals protein first THEN veg THEN fruit THEN carb (if there's any room left - after surgery you'll be lucky to finish the protein and a bite of the veg) - if you're not exercising, start walking 10 minutes a day EVERY day and increase it until you are walking 8000 steps a day - stop drinking soda or anything carbonated completely - stop smoking if you smoke -

The Methodist Hospital Dallas Monthly Support Group Meeting is held every third Tuesday of the month at 6pm. This is the facility in Oak Cliff on the corner of Beckley and Colorado. Park in Garage B (validation available) and the meeting is held in the Weiss Auditorium next to Pavillion 2. -
